Whether I’m leading our local #TuesdaysTogether meet-up or collaborating with others in the industry, I derive as much joy from working with small business owners as I do working with couples. When Easton, Maryland-based wedding planner Kari Rider of  Kari Rider Events contacted me about creating custom welcome gifts for her event planning clients, I was over the moon. Kari’s brand is tasteful and luxurious and together with her white, blue, and gold color palette, we called upon these key elements of her brand to create her unique gift design.

Each of Kari’s wedding clients received a gorgeous white, high-gloss hat box finished off with dusty blue silk ribbon. One of my favorite details is the gift tag that says, “Cheers”, because it acts as such a fun sneak peek for what is waiting for each couple to discover inside!

There are few things more celebratory than champagne, so a mini bottle of bubbly was a must! Of course champagne is best paired with chocolate, so we included artisan chocolates with beautiful gold foil packaging.

Lastly, a grey pashmina awaits each bride. Similar to a couple’s relationship with their wedding planner, we knew we wanted to include a piece that was everlasting, while still chic and current.

For a final touch, each gift contained personal words from Kari herself. I can only imagine how special each couple will feel as they open the box that we drop-shipped to their home. I only wish I could be there to witness these moments in-person!
